We&#8217;ll never know. But PG&amp;E&#8217;s blackouts aren&#8217;t a panacea. They can&#8217;t be. Power lines can <a href=\"https:\/\/mashable.com\/article\/camp-fire-deadliest-california-history\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\">instigate horrific blazes<\/a>, but wind-whipped power lines have conclusively lit only <a href=\"https:\/\/www.fire.ca.gov\/media\/5510\/top20_acres.pdf\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ener noreferrer\">four out of the 20<\/a> largest wildfires in state history. Other human causes (<a href=\"https:\/\/me.mashable.com\/science\/5427\/a-hammer-started-the-largest-wildfire-in-california-history\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\">like the use of a hammer<\/a> or car fires) and lightning strikes stoked 14 of the Golden State&#8217;s worst infernos.\u00a0<\/p>\n<div class=\"twitter-wrapper sort-rerender\">\n<div>\n<blockquote class=\"twitter-tweet\">\n<p dir=\"ltr\" lang=\"en\">1. This is, of course, an expected consequence of a <a href=\"https:\/\/me.mashable.com\/science\/6115\/june-was-the-warmest-june-ever-recorded-but-theres-a-bigger-problem\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\">relentlessly warming climate<\/a>.\u00a0<\/p>\n<p>PG&amp;E, who <a href=\"https:\/\/www.kqed.org\/news\/11737336\/judge-pge-paid-out-stock-dividends-instead-of-trimming-trees\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ener noreferrer\">according to KQED News<\/a> was responsible for 18 wildfires in 2017 and rewarded its investors with $4.5 billion while simultaneously underfunding wildfire mitigation, may have its hands full for decades ahead, at least. Avoiding wildfires is onerous in fire country that&#8217;s <a href=\"https:\/\/mashable.com\/article\/wildfire-burn-how-long-climate-change\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\">becoming more prone to fires<\/a>.<\/p>\n<p>&#8220;They&#8217;re dealing with wildfires that are a direct function of climate change,&#8221; said Stokes. &#8220;Society is woefully unprepared for the impacts of climate change.&#8221;<\/p>\n<\/div>\n\n<!-- Quick Adsense WordPress Plugin: http:\/\/quickadsense.com\/ -->\n<div class=\"c5b541d88d911dcbb84397def1a3492d\" data-index=\"5\" style=\"float: none; margin:0px 0 0px 0; text-align:center;\">\n<script async src=\"https:\/\/pagead2.googlesyndication.com\/pagead\/js\/adsbygoogle.js\"><\/script>\r\n<!-- 5 -->\r\n<ins class=\"adsbygoogle\"\r\n     style=\"display:block\"\r\n     data-ad-client=\"ca-pub-3943282228430444\"\r\n     data-ad-slot=\"9258826580\"\r\n     data-ad-format=\"auto\"\r\n     data-full-width-responsive=\"true\"><\/ins>\r\n<script>\r\n     (adsbygoogle = window.adsbygoogle || []).push({});\r\n<\/script>\n<\/div>\n[ad_2]\n<br \/><a href=\"https:\/\/me.mashable.com\/science\/7392\/californias-climate-dystopia-comes-true\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\">Source link <\/a><\/p>\n\n<!-- Quick Adsense WordPress Plugin: http:\/\/quickadsense.com\/ -->\n<div class=\"c5b541d88d911dcbb84397def1a3492d\" data-index=\"3\" style=\"float: none; margin:0px 0 0px 0; text-align:center;\">\n<script async src=\"https:\/\/pagead2.googlesyndication.com\/pagead\/js\/adsbygoogle.js\"><\/script>\r\n<!-- 3 -->\r\n<ins class=\"adsbygoogle\"\r\n     style=\"display:block\"\r\n     data-ad-client=\"ca-pub-3943282228430444\"\r\n     data-ad-slot=\"2884989920\"\r\n     data-ad-format=\"auto\"\r\n     data-full-width-responsive=\"true\"><\/ins>\r\n<script>\r\n     (adsbygoogle = window.adsbygoogle || []).push({});\r\n<\/script>\n<\/div>\n\n<div style=\"font-size: 0px; height: 0px; line-height: 0px; margin: 0; padding: 0; clear: both;\"><\/div>","protected":false},"excerpt":{"rendered":"<p>[ad_1] On October 9, 2019, Pacific Gas and Electric started the blackouts.\u00a0 The beleaguered utility, which oversees 125,000 miles of electrical and transmission lines in the fire-plagued Golden State, warned that an unprecedented 800,000 customers, meaning some 2 million Californians, could go without power for days or longer during the October power shutoff.\u00a0 It&#8217;s a &hellip;<\/p>\n","protected":false},"author":1,"featured_media":78755,"comment_status":"open","ping_status":"open","sticky":false,"template":"","format":"standard","meta":[],"categories":[9],"tags":[],"_links":{"self":[{"href":"https:\/\/newsforher.com\/index.php?rest_route=\/wp\/v2\/posts\/78754"}],"collection":[{"href":"https:\/\/newsforher.com\/index.php?rest_route=\/wp\/v2\/posts"}],"about":[{"href":"https:\/\/newsforher.com\/index.php?rest_route=\/wp\/v2\/types\/post"}],"author":[{"embeddable":true,"href":"https:\/\/newsforher.com\/index.php?rest_route=\/wp\/v2\/users\/1"}],"replies":[{"embeddable":true,"href":"https:\/\/newsforher.com\/index.php?rest_route=%2Fwp%2Fv2%2Fcomments&post=78754"}],"version-history":[{"count":1,"href":"https:\/\/newsforher.com\/index.php?rest_route=\/wp\/v2\/posts\/78754\/revisions"}],"predecessor-version":[{"id":78756,"href":"https:\/\/newsforher.com\/index.php?rest_route=\/wp\/v2\/posts\/78754\/revisions\/78756"}],"wp:featuredmedia":[{"embeddable":true,"href":"https:\/\/newsforher.com\/index.php?rest_route=\/wp\/v2\/media\/78755"}],"wp:attachment":[{"href":"https:\/\/newsforher.com\/index.php?rest_route=%2Fwp%2Fv2%2Fmedia&parent=78754"}],"wp:term":[{"taxonomy":"category","embeddable":true,"href":"https:\/\/newsforher.com\/index.php?rest_route=%2Fwp%2Fv2%2Fcategories&post=78754"},{"taxonomy":"post_tag","embeddable":true,"href":"https:\/\/newsforher.com\/index.php?rest_route=%2Fwp%2Fv2%2Ftags&post=78754"}],"curies":[{"name":"wp","href":"https:\/\/api.w.org\/{rel}","templated":true}]}}
